9.3.8.2
ASSOCIATING A RADIO BASE STATION WITH A TRUNK GROUP
To declare the radio base station and put it in service, use the MMC XBORFA and select
the "radio station" object.
Note:
When declaring a DECT trunk group in a cell, all radio base stations in the cell
must be disabled. A cell may include no more than eight radio base stations.
CCU (cluster)
Mandatory parameter, with a value between 2 and 39, corresponding to the cluster
supporting the DECT interface card.
Board type
Mandatory parameter used to select the type of card supporting the radio base
station:
Number
Mandatory parameter, with a value between 0 and 7, corresponding to the CLX
card number,
Access
Mandatory parameter used to enter the access number corresponding to the
position of the radio base station on the card:
Trunk Gp
Mandatory parameter, with a value between 0 and 61, corresponding to the trunk
associated with this cell,
Radst (radio base station)
Enter the number of channels (2 or 4) for this radio base station.
The LDS card must be fitted with ADPCM daughter cards in order to support 4-channel
radio base stations.
On declaration of each base station, note its position on the diagram (cluster, card, PBX
channel).
TS Frame assignment
Leave default values.
Frequency assignment
Leave default values.
Anten.choice
You can connect two external antennas to the upper connectors of the base
station. In this case it may be necessary to force antenna selection. In the majority
of the cases, enter "AUTOMATIC".
Type of Radst (type of radio base station)
Select External for a 2-pair operational configuration. Select master or slave
depending on the mode of the base station for other cases.
